       Hazardous Areas – Autogas Tanker Delivery

       A new section of the standard deals with autogas.  The zones around an autogas tanker during delivery are quite
       different to those for a petrol tanker.

       A Zone 2 hazardous area surrounds the pump which would normally be mounted  on the delivery vehicle.
       Surrounding  the relief valve there is an additional Zone 2 of 0.5m (or 2.5m for a non-soft seat valve).  A Zone 1
       of 1.5m radius is applied to the ullage level indicator on the vehicle.






















       Hazardous Areas – Autogas Tanks

       The hazardous zones around autogas tanks and filling points are another addition to the new guidance.  Where
       petrol tanks have 1m hazardous areas around the chambers,  autogas has areas of 1.5m radius.
